Kilómetro Diecisiete Y Medio (Cerro Prieto Cuarta Sección)

Kilómetro Diecisiete Y Medio (Cerro Prieto Cuarta Sección) is located at a height of 12 meters above sea level in the municipality of Mexicali (FaZ-Los) in Baja California, Mexico. Its geographic location is at latitude: 32.4475 and longitude: -115.378333.

Population

Kilómetro Diecisiete Y Medio (Cerro Prieto Cuarta Sección) is populated by 14 people. The total population consists of 0 children aged 0 to 2 years, 0 aged 3 to 5 years, 1 children aged 6 to 11 years, 1 teenagers between 12 and 14 years and 1 aged 15 to 17 years. The number of adult people aged 18 to 24 is 0, in the age group of 25 to 60 years are 7 people and the over 60 years old people are represented by 4 people.

Dividing the overall population of 14 inhabitants in only three age groups result in: 2 people aged 0 to 14, 6 people aged 15 to 64 and 3 people aged 65 or more years. The male-female ratio is 100 men per 100 woman and the birth rate (fertility rate) is 2 children per woman.
